Mokyo, a cozy nook in the heart of the East Village, is the sister restaurant to Thursday Kitchen. At both places, Chef Kyungmin Hyun’s frequent strategy is to rewire familiar dishes; when a dish isn’t already Korean, she adds a component that is. Each of them involve ingredients you wouldn't typically find mingling together, like truffle salsa verde or pork jowl with kabayaki butter.
